Our selections for the Lexus, Mackinnon & Derby are below. Please keep in mind that these selections are based on a dead track at Flemington. With the predicted rain we expect a downgrade from a Good3 to the Dead range. With that in mind here we go. Race 5 is the Lexus Stks over 2500m. The first of our selections is No.2 Caravan Rolls On. He was the winner of the Gp3 Geelong Cup last start in good fashion and needs to win this to gain a start in Tuesdays Melbourne Cup. A few of todays rivals ran behind him on that occasion and despite going up 4kg in weight we expect him to be in the finish. Second of our selections is No. 9 Signoff. Coming through a different form line to Caravans Roll On, he was a closing third to two European raiders in the Gp3 David Jones Cup at Caulfield. He is another that must win to gain entry into the Melbourne Cup and gains Joao Moreira for the ride, will be a big threat. Behind these two we had a little cluster of horses that may be fighting out the minors. These are 3, 5, 10, & 11. Race 6 is the Group 1 Mackinnon Stks. This is a wide open event so we will give you our top three and a roughie, then you can add anything else you might like. First selection is No.13 Criterion. Was a little unlucky when checked early and forced wide in the Cox Plate and didnt shirk his task when a game 7th only 1.5 lengths off the winner. Won or placed at 4 from 5 over this trip and will be hard to hold out if last weeks run hasnt taken too much out of him. Our next selection is the N.Z mare No.15 Rising Romance. Ran a cracking second to Melbourne Cup favourite Admire Rakti last start in the Caulfield Cup. Connections have elected not to go toward the Melbourne cup and have dropped her back in trip to this event. If she can dash at the back end of this race, it will take a good effort to hold her out. Third of them is Mourinho. a winner of the listed Cranbourne Cup last start and has been super consistent this time in. Not sure that the Cranbourne formline is strong enough but going to well to ignore and Craig Newitt has stayed on. Our Roughie is No. 14 Costume. She won a Gp1 last start in NZ over the 2040m. While this is toughe, she goes well at the trip and will be there abouts. Beware track going with this runner. If the track ends up on the worse side of Dead it could play against her. Just in behind these are 4,8,12. Race 7. The Derby. Group1 3yo. 2500m. Tough event to sort out as none of these have been over the trip. First selection is No.2 Moonovermanhattan. winner of the Group 2 Vase last start and that race has provided 7 of the last 10 winners of the derby. He came out of a similar Barrier last start and rolled forward, then shot away at the turn. Expect him to roll forward again and will take some running down if he can get the trip. Next selection is No.1 Hampton Court. From the waterhouse stable he was the winner of the Group 1 Spring Champion Stakes in Sydney. He sat back in the field and was able to explode over the top of them off a hot pace. Looked strong going to the post and expect hell get the trip, will be in the finish. Third pick is No. 11 Atmosphere. Had to sustain a wide run in the Vase last start and was a gallant second. Gives the impression that he will see out the 2500m and Moreira goes on. Being a Maiden is a small concern but has placed at his last 3 in a row. Should give a sight. No.5 is Magicool. Was always in trouble last start and was game running 5th. Draw is no help and will more than likely have to go back at the start. Looks fairly dour but with G.Boss on board could be the one looming late. Could be your value runner. The last of our selected runners is No. 8 Light Up Manhattan. Has been running on at his last couple of starts and is out of a Zabeel mare. Expect him to be coming late when some of the others may be out of gas. Should settle just of the pace and will be chiming in over the last 400m.
